2 defensive driving course instructors, a road marshall and 5 private individuals appear in court

Two defensive driving course instructors, a road marshall and five private individuals appeared in the Nasinu Magistrates Court in the last hour.

According to the FICAC charges, defensive driving instructor and LTA Training Officer, Manoa Naitala is charged with three counts of corrupt transaction with agents.

It is alleged that Naitala intended to deceive the Land Transport Authority by using various documents containing false information, in respect of which the LTA has interest in, namely the Defensive Driving Course test results and attendance details of Manoj Kumar, Jerry Nand and Frank Whippy, in the Nominal Roll form, knowing that the documents will mislead LTA.

The alleged incidents occurred on or about 20th April this year.

Naitala has been remanded in custody until tomorrow as he has to provide two sureties.

The second defensive driving instructor Rajnesh Prasad is charged with two counts of corrupt transaction with agents, one count of bribery and one count of general dishonesty - obtaining a gain.

It is alleged that he falsified documents for the defensive driving course certificate for Raymond Singh and Mohammed Yunus.

It is also alleged that Prasad accepted an advantage of $150 from Shan Mohammed, a person acting on behalf of Mohammed Yunus, on account of performing an act in his capacity as a public servant in LTA.

These alleged incidents occurred on or about June 2015.

Prasad is remanded in custody until tomorrow to present suitable sureties.

Road Marshall, Ranjina Hicks is charged with 4 counts of general dishonesty - obtaining a gain.

It is alleged that Hicks made arrangements with Gitendra Prasad, Rakesh Kumar, Frank Whippy and Saras Wati for the issuance of Defensive Driving Certificates without following due processes of the LTA.

Hicks also allegedly received $250, $300, $176 and $50 in return for these certificates.

Jerry Nand, Manoj Kumar, Mohammed Yunus, Gitendra Prasad and Frank Whippy are each charged with attempting to obtain a gain.

They allegedly attempted to acquire Defensive Driving Certificates without following due processes of LTA.

These alleged incidents occurred between 2015 and 2016.

Frank Whippy has been remanded in custody till tomorrow.

Jerry Nand, Yunus Ali, Manoj Kumar and Gitendra Prasad have been released with strict bail conditions.

They will take their plea on the 9th of January next year.
